Update on 'Eklavya' controversy

The Honorable High Court bench of the learned Chief Justice Swatantra Veer Kumar and Justice D Y Chandrachud has heard the matter yesterday (29-09-2007) in the matter of selection of 'Eklavya – The Royal Guard' to represent India at the ensuing 80th Annual Academy Awards. The said selection was based on entries received by the Film Federation of India.
Accordingly, the Honorable High Court was informed that based upon the said selection and communication from the Film Federation of India, in conformity with the guidelines of the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ences, USA, the entry was sent on 26-09-2007 and the print of 'Eklavya – The Royal Guard' on 28-09-2007 prior to the receipt of the notice of the hearing of the matter, so as to reach the Academy within the stipulated time limit of 01-10-2007.
The Honorable High Court has not issued any restraining order/stay or injunction in the matter. Now the matter will be heard on 10-10-2007.
